Hi, I have a problem with my new Gigabyte GTX 1060. The HDMI port doesn't send a signal to any of my TVs. DVI works fine. I had even sent the previous 1060 on RMA thinking it was a HDMI port problem after reading others having this issue online but the new one just arrived and same issue. I tried on 2 different TVs, 5(five!) different HDMI cables and my monitor without success. Oddly the TV detects that my PC is plugged into it but just no video signal. The cable works cos I can use it for my internal GPU and used to use it on my previous 970. Is this some kind of HDMI 2.0 vs older HDMI versions issue? I thought they are backwards compatible...

PS: before anyone asks yes the 6pin is plugged in.

TV doesn't have a DVI port. I think you mean the other way DVI-> HDMI adapter. While I appreciate the suggestion I managed to fix it somehow by updating my TV firmware and the latest NVidia drivers. Not sure how either is related to the issue but it started working all of a sudden. I suspect maybe the TV HDMI port wasn't getting enough or the right voltage? Nothing mentioned in the changelog about something like that though... Maybe the Nvidia drivers detect HDMI hardware better? I only jumped from 391 to 395...
